---------------------------------------------------------------------------
--- Layoutbox widget.
--
-- @author Julien Danjou <julien@danjou.info>
-- @copyright 2009 Julien Danjou
-- @classmod awful.widget.layoutbox
---------------------------------------------------------------------------

local setmetatable = setmetatable
local capi = { screen = screen, tag = tag }
local layout = require("awful.layout")
local tooltip = require("awful.tooltip")
local wibox = require("wibox")
local surface = require("gears.surface")

local layout_icons = {
	cornernw = "",
	cornerne = "",
	cornersw = "",
	cornerse = "",
	fairh = "",
	fairv = "",
	max = "[M]",
	floating  = "><>",
	magnifier = "[M]",
	fullscreen = "",
	spiral = "",
	dwindle = "",
	tile = "[]=",
	tiletop  = "TTT",
	tilebottom  = "TTT",
	tileleft  = "=[]",
}

local function get_screen(s)
	return s and capi.screen[s]
end

local layoutbox = { mt = {} }

local boxes = nil

local function update(w, screen)
	screen = get_screen(screen)
	local name = layout.getname(layout.get(screen))
	w._layoutbox_tooltip:set_text(name or "[no name]")

	if name == "max" and #screen.clients > 0 then
		w.textbox.text = " [" .. #screen.clients .. "] " -- TODO manage / unmanage signal
		return
	end

	w.textbox.text = layout_icons[name]
	w.textbox.text = " " .. w.textbox.text .. " "
end

local function update_from_tag(t)
	local screen = get_screen(t.screen)
	local w = boxes[screen]
	if w then
		update(w, screen)
	end
end

--- Create a layoutbox widget. It draws a picture with the current layout
-- symbol of the current tag.
-- @param screen The screen number that the layout will be represented for.
-- @return An imagebox widget configured as a layoutbox.
function layoutbox.new(screen)
	screen = get_screen(screen or 1)

	-- Do we already have the update callbacks registered?
	if boxes == nil then
		boxes = setmetatable({}, { __mode = "kv" })
		capi.tag.connect_signal("property::selected", update_from_tag)
		capi.tag.connect_signal("property::layout", update_from_tag)
		capi.tag.connect_signal("property::screen", function()
			for s, w in pairs(boxes) do
				if s.valid then
					update(w, s)
				end
			end
		end)
		layoutbox.boxes = boxes
	end

	-- Do we already have a layoutbox for this screen?
	local w = boxes[screen]
	if not w then
		w = wibox.widget {
			{
				id     = "textbox",
				widget = wibox.widget.textbox
			},
			layout = wibox.layout.fixed.horizontal
		}

		w._layoutbox_tooltip = tooltip {objects = {w}, delay_show = 1}

		update(w, screen)
		boxes[screen] = w
	end

	return w
end

function layoutbox.mt:__call(...)
	return layoutbox.new(...)
end

return setmetatable(layoutbox, layoutbox.mt)
